3.28 IEEE1394 test program

This section describes how to perform the IEEE1394 test with the test program.

NOTE: Use another computer that can communicate by IEEE1394 (i. Link) cable as a reference machine to perform this test.

Toshiba MS-DOS is required to run the DIAGNOSTICS TEST PROGRAM. To start the DIAGNOSTIC TEST PROGRAM, follow these steps:

Insert the Diagnostics disk in the floppy disk drive and turn on the computer. (The Diagnostics Disk contains the MS-DOS boot files.)

The following menu will appear:

To execute the TEST, select the test number you want to execute and press Enter.

Subtest 01

IEEE1394 test

 

Specifies the data size and transfer speed between the responder connected

 

with a responding cable, and sends and receives data. A dedicated cable for

 

I-link is necessary.

Subtest 02

Responder tool

 

This program initializes the machine responder.

Subtest 03

ID Check

 

This program displays the GUID.
